工控机软件系统主要由以下三部分组成:
1. 操作系统(Operating System):这是工控机的软件基础,负责管理计算机硬件资源,提供用户界面,支持多种应用程序运行。常见的工控机操作系统有Windows、Linux、UNIX等。
2. 嵌入式实时操作系统(Embedded Real-Time Operating System):这是专门为工业控制领域设计的实时操作系统,具有高可靠性、实时性等特点。它能够保证工控机在各种复杂环境下的稳定运行,满足工业自动化对实时性和准确性的要求。常见的嵌入式实时操作系统有RTOS、VxWorks等。
3. 应用软件(Application Software):这是根据工控机的使用需求,由用户或开发人员开发的特定功能的程序。这些程序可以是简单的数据采集、处理和显示,也可以是复杂的生产过程控制、设备诊断和故障排除等。应用软件的开发需要考虑工控机的硬件配置、通信协议、编程语言等因素。
这三部分共同构成了工控机软件系统,它们相互关联、相互依赖,共同为工控机提供强大的计算、处理和通信能力,使工控机能够满足工业生产中的多样化需求。